Alternative Treatments Based On Natural Hormones Are Becoming Increasingly Popular For Treating Perimenopause Or Menopause Symptoms
 
Treatments for menopause symptoms derived from natural hormones.
There are a number of types of natural plant based treatments for perimenopause symptoms. Perhaps the most widely used are made from plants rich in natural phytoestrogens, sometimes known as isoflavones, which are chemically very similar to the natural estrogen produced by the ovaries. The effectiveness of these types of treatments relies on the assumption that phytoestrogens have the same effect in the body as the body's own natural hormones. High levels of phytoestrogens are found in food products made from soy, and herbs such as dong quai, licorice root and black cohosh.
Some doctors believe that declining levels of progesterone have a more significant role in causing menopause symptoms than is conventionally believed. Natural treatments which are designed to restore progesterone levels most commonly take the form of a topically applied cream made from an extract of Mexican wild yam, which contains a substance similar to human progesterone. Natural progesterone treatments may also involve taking supplements of extracts from herbs such as chaste tree berry.
